Understanding Park Usership 

 Understanding Park Usership 

  Download PDF Now (1275KB)

Summary:

User surveys can reveal valuable information that can help parks managers operate more effectively and respond to people’s needs. But many parks have not taken full advantage of these powerful research tools because they lack the resources and skills. This second policy brief in a series from the Urban Institute, based on Wallace’s Urban Parks Initiative, introduces five data-collection methods and gives examples of how parks used them to improve the services they offer.
